When you budget for a new fireplace, the final number depends on several moving parts. Choosing between a simple electric insert and a complex gas or wood-burning setup changes labor needs significantly. If your home already has a chimney or gas line, costs stay lower. If we need to run new venting, cut into walls, or add custom stonework, the labor and material requirements increase. Electric models are generally the most straightforward to install because they do not require gas lines or chimney venting. Costs are mainly influenced by whether you choose a wall-mounted unit or a recessed model that requires framing. Factors like adding dedicated outlets or custom cabinetry will affect the final total. The '2-10 rule' often pertains to chimney height requirements: the chimney must extend at least 2 feet above any part of the structure within a 10-foot horizontal distance. This ensures proper draft and fire safety. Licensed installers in Nashville strictly follow these important regulations.
